I was in the NY office this past summer. I have not heard any talk whatsoever of no-offers. I am very skeptical there were no-offers here, as this office is traditionally 100% offer and everyone I've spoken to has a permanent offer (Proskauer even gave permanent offers to the 1Ls this year).
Of course, I can't speak for other offices and Proskauer wasn't 100% offer last year at some of the satellites.
